Biography

Dr. Deborah Olubamise is a Lecturer II in the Agricultural Education Unit, Department of Science Education, Faculty of Education, Federal University Oye-Ekiti, Nigeria, where she currently serves as the Head of the Agricultural Education Unit. She holds a Doctor of Philosophy (Ph.D.) in Agricultural Education, a Master of Education (M.Ed.) in Science Education, and a Postgraduate Diploma in Education (PGDE) from Ekiti State University, Ado-Ekiti, as well as a Bachelor of Agriculture (B.Agric.) from the University of Ilorin. She also possesses a Diploma in Computer and Internet Literacy.

Dr. Olubamise has over two decades of professional experience in teaching, educational administration, and academic leadership. Before joining the Federal University Oye-Ekiti, she served as an Adjunct Lecturer at Ekiti State University and a Part-Time Lecturer in the Directorate of Continuing Education Programmes. She previously held leadership positions in secondary education, including Head of the Vocational and Technology Department and Vice Principal (Administration), where she contributed significantly to curriculum development and educational management.

Her research interests include Agricultural Education, Science Education, Entrepreneurship Education, Educational Technology, STEM Education, Sustainable Agricultural Development, and Technical and Vocational Education. She is committed to innovative teaching, quality research, student mentorship, and community engagement.
